Another taste of the cask Pirate Pale. This is getting good now. The beer is nicely clear although not quite crystal clear. The yeastiness has gone, the zesty flavours and a little apricot are coming through, the bitterness is fairly high but not at all harsh, soft mouthfeel, and a long lasting foamy head.
